They are bigger screens, which many people may prefer. They also have touchscreens, which many people may prefer.

The Lenovo Yoga has an OLED screen, I am somewhat doubtful the average person would find it worse than the screen on the Neo.

https://www.cpu-monkey.com/en/compare_cpu-apple_a18_pro-vs-a...

The Ryzen AI 340 isn't a bad match against the A18 Pro. It's actually ahead of the A18 Pro on multicore performance, and only 20% behind on single core benchmarks, not enough for anyone to notice. Yeah, it's true you're losing a lot of integrated GPU performance. Integrated GPUs do need more RAM, though, and I doubt the Neo is going to be handle a lot in the realm of "high school kids who want to game on the side" between that and the software compatibility situation.
